深入解析VPN 712故障,常见问题与网络工程师的排查指南

hk258369 2026-02-01 VPN梯子 3 0

在现代企业与远程办公日益普及的背景下,虚拟私人网络(VPN)已成为保障数据传输安全、实现跨地域访问的核心技术之一,当用户报告“VPN 712”错误时,这通常意味着连接失败或认证异常,而作为网络工程师,我们不能仅停留在表面报错,而应系统性地定位问题根源,本文将深入分析“VPN 712”这一错误代码的可能成因,并提供一套完整的排查流程与解决方案。

我们需要明确“VPN 712”是什么?在大多数情况下,该错误码出现在Windows操作系统下的PPTP或L2TP/IPsec类型的VPN连接中,表示“认证失败”或“服务器未响应”,它可能指向以下几种情况:

  1. 身份验证凭证错误:最常见的是用户名或密码输入错误,尤其是在使用域账户登录时,忘记添加域名前缀(如DOMAIN\username)会导致认证失败,密码过期、账户锁定或权限不足也会触发此错误。

  2. 证书问题:若使用IPsec协议进行加密通信,客户端与服务器之间的数字证书不匹配或已过期,会导致握手失败,从而返回712错误,此时需检查证书是否被信任、是否位于正确的存储位置(如“受信任的根证书颁发机构”)。

  3. 防火墙或NAT干扰:某些企业级防火墙或路由器会阻止PPTP(端口1723)或L2TP(UDP 500和UDP 4500)流量,导致隧道无法建立,即使本地测试正常,公网侧的策略也可能拦截请求,建议在网络边缘设备上检查ACL规则与端口开放状态。

  4. 服务器端配置错误:如果这是企业内部自建的VPN服务器(如Windows Server上的RRAS服务),则需确认RADIUS服务器配置正确、用户数据库同步无误,以及IKE策略(如加密算法、密钥交换方式)与客户端兼容。

  5. DNS解析问题:若客户端尝试通过主机名连接服务器,但DNS无法解析该地址(如server.vpn.company.com),也可能表现为连接超时或712错误,此时应检查本地hosts文件、DNS缓存或尝试直接用IP地址测试连接。

作为网络工程师,我们的排查步骤应遵循从简单到复杂的原则:

第一步:确认用户输入信息是否准确(包括账号、密码、服务器地址)。
第二步:在客户端执行ping <vpn-server-ip>nslookup <vpn-server-hostname>,排除网络连通性和DNS问题。
第三步:启用Windows事件查看器中的“网络策略服务器”日志,查找详细错误描述(如809、816等更具体的错误码)。
第四步:在服务器端检查日志(如Windows Event Viewer中的“Security”和“System”日志),确认是否有来自客户端的连接尝试记录。
第五步:使用Wireshark抓包分析,观察是否成功完成TCP三次握手、L2TP控制通道建立、IPsec SA协商过程,从而定位是哪一阶段失败。

建议在企业环境中部署集中式日志管理平台(如Splunk或ELK),并定期对VPN配置进行合规性审计,对于频繁出现712错误的用户,可考虑升级至更安全的OpenVPN或WireGuard协议,减少对老旧协议(如PPTP)的依赖。

“VPN 712”不是简单的“连接失败”,而是网络链路、认证机制与安全策略共同作用的结果,只有系统化排查、精准定位,才能真正解决问题,保障企业网络的安全与稳定运行。

深入解析VPN 712故障,常见问题与网络工程师的排查指南